Java 转 GO 还是 Rust

2023-11-03 08:58:39 +08:00
 williamshan

目前是一名 Java 程序员,觉得学的再深入知识也掌握不完,东西太多了,各种框架。我在想把这些精力放到新兴的语言上,比如 Rust 或者 Go ,是不是效果会更好点,相比来说没那么卷。 最近在学 Rust ,觉得 Rust 这门语言还是有未来的,大家怎么看?

10816 次点击
所在节点    程序员
97 条回复
jonsmith
2023-11-03 10:02:51 +08:00
我是 go 想转 Java ,虽然很喜欢 go ,奈何二线城市工作太少,Java 岗位远多于其他语言。
如果单纯兴趣,推荐可以学习 go 。
forQ
2023-11-03 10:06:16 +08:00
“觉得学的再深入知识也掌握不完,东西太多了,各种框架”

go 没有这个问题吗,rust 没有这个问题吗?
assiadamo
2023-11-03 10:09:01 +08:00
出海的话感觉 c#好一点,就业市场比 go 大
dinghmcn
2023-11-03 10:21:30 +08:00
@tedzhou1221 #21 Clash for windows 没了?
wupher
2023-11-03 10:25:13 +08:00
both
hancai
2023-11-03 10:33:46 +08:00
rust 没岗位 没岗位
17681880207
2023-11-03 10:40:13 +08:00
换成 go 也好 rust 也好,如果你还是开发后台管理系统,那不和 java 一样吗?重要的是你那语言来干嘛,而不是用什么语言。😗
xiaocaiji111
2023-11-03 10:50:50 +08:00
都学不完,计算机换了个语言你会发现框架,最佳实践,编程技巧都要再来一遍。
好好深入 java ,然后学一门辅助语言来解决 java 解决不了,或者不适合解决的场景。如果不断的换语言,估计也就是图个语法新鲜感。啥都会,啥都又不会。
xuanbg
2023-11-03 10:52:59 +08:00
没有谁能把知识学完,都是用什么学什么。再说,go 还不是直接就能上手的吗?
lsk569937453
2023-11-03 11:02:40 +08:00
java 是工作,rust 是生活。
jjx
2023-11-03 11:09:32 +08:00
关注语言没有意思

应该是关注哪个业务是你喜欢的, 把剩余精力投注到业务背后的专业知识

比方说 进销存/erp, 你就应该把剩余精力放在 财务会计, 企业管理上,这些专业知识值得穷极一生, 而且受益终生

语言之类的, 没有这个价值
daye
2023-11-03 11:10:53 +08:00
学习 rust 赌未来几年物联网会上风口
Dogtler
2023-11-03 11:15:39 +08:00
与前端不同,在后端 语言不再是痛楚 后端其实与所处的行业绑定,只要能规划一套可行的技术方案业务。
所以公司用啥就学啥就好,行业主流用啥就学啥就行,懂得行业的运作和灵活运用语言其本身
tietou
2023-11-03 11:15:53 +08:00
不需要转 都学
kirito41dd
2023-11-03 11:24:58 +08:00
go 入门之要半天,rust 一定要学,所以俩都要。
我上份工作 go ,现在工作 rust
NoNewWorld
2023-11-03 11:27:01 +08:00
rust 一步到位,不过我倒是选择了 C++
ShadowPower
2023-11-03 11:29:52 +08:00
学 rust ,了解它的设计对编程思路很有帮助,哪怕不写 rust 。
go 的话,需要的时候分分钟就学会了。它本身的特性特别少,不需要专门去学,看着代码模仿都可以写出来。
lbp0200
2023-11-03 11:38:47 +08:00
Java 的 23 种设计模式,你知道么?
tangtang369
2023-11-03 11:39:39 +08:00
语言是学不完的 一通百通 只要知道基本规则就行
tedzhou1221
2023-11-03 11:45:39 +08:00
😆java 的 23 种设计模式…….哈哈
看来还是有必要学学 Java 以外的东西。不然以为编程=Java

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/988098

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X